STM32F302xB STM32F302xC STM32F303xB STM32F303xC
ARM Cortex-M4F 32b MCU+FPU, up to 256KB Flash+48KB SRAM 4 ADCs, 2 DAC ch., 7 comp, 4 PGA, timers, 2.0-3.6 V operation
Datasheet − production data
Features

Core: ARM® 32-bit Cortex™-M4F CPU (72 MHz max), single-cycle multiplication and HW division, DSP instruction with FPU (floating-point unit) and MPU (memory protection unit). Operating conditions: – VDD, VDDA
voltage range: 2.0 V to 3.6 V Memories – 128 to 256 Kbytes of Flash memory – Up to 40 Kbytes of SRAM on data bus with HW parity check – 8 Kbytes of SRAM on instruction bus with HW parity check (CCM) CRC calculation unit Reset and supply management – Power-on/Power down reset (POR/PDR) – Programmable
voltage detector (PVD) – Low power modes: Sleep, Stop and Standby – VBAT supply for RTC and backup registers Clock management – 4 to 32 MHz crystal oscillator – 32 kHz oscillator for RTC with calibration – Internal 8 MHz RC with x 16 PLL option – Internal 40 kHz oscillator Up to 87 fast I/Os – All mappable on external interrupt vectors – Several 5 V-tolerant 12-channel DMA controller Up to four ADC 0.20 µS (up to 39 channels) with selectable resolution of 12/10/8/6 bits, 0 to 3.6 V conversion range, separate analog supply from 2 to 3.6 V Up to two 12-bit DAC channels with analog supply from 2.4 to 3.6 V Seven fast rail-to-rail analog comparators with analog supply from 2 to 3.6 V Up to four operational
